and she works very well with Fibaro

 

What I have found to make her work every time is:

 

  • remember she knows nothing about rooms.
  • rename any devices with complex names-- you can spot these as they will confuse her
  • remove any devices that you do not want to control--my wife turned the heating on with the outside temperature close to 30 Celsius. OK my fault as I am the man and I should have thought of that.
  • rename devices that  still confuse her (bless!).

 

and if she is disobedient remember she is not human.
